twooldgoats 07-27-2013 11:02 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by rocky (Post 4984523)
..... You go thru tech and they break you balls about well next month you belts are out of date. Well on the other hand never look at the ballancer or the trans shield or peek his head under the car to see if there is a loop around the drive shaft....My point here is why is only the belts and helmet only this they zone on.

They zone in on belts and helmets, because it's easier and faster. Unfortunately, NHRA has taken advantage of the real need for safety and used it to line the pockets of the safety equipment manufacturers and retailers. However, safety is really important. I keep my car current to protect myself, knowing that some of the requirements are ridiculous overkill. I just pulled my engine yesterday and noticed the flexplate is dated Sep, 2011. That sent me scurrying to the rule book to make sure it's a three-year cert and not just two.

I personally like it when they go over the cars more thoroughly. After all, I may not know the car in the lane next to me. I've raced cars at ten or so different tracks and the tech guy at Wichita years ago is the only one who ever got down on his hands and knees and looked underneath.
